Hammer and Sickle Symbols

Description
Adds Hammer and Sickle symbols for Ideoligion.

The base icon is white with a black border so you can choose whatever colour you want to fill the inner section with.
Maybe I'll add more variations later if there's demand for it.

Disclaimer: This is not necessarily an expression or endorsement of views.
These are simply symbols for players to use however they wish in RimWorld for role-playing purposes.

Pseudoku  [author] 29 Oct, 2021 @ 2:06pm 
Hello @i_starving, this was my first RimWorld mod :D:

Turns out Icon mods are very simple, just need to create some XML files.

I used the tutorial at https://rimworldwiki.com/wiki/Modding_Tutorials

You can go to your Rimworld steam directory (<game installation folder>\steamapps\workshop\content\294100) and take a look at any of the mods you have installed for reference (or find this mod in that folder).
